Previous   Next
Home » CPA0010499

China: Zhaoguli Buddhist Temple, Subashi Ancient City (Subashi Gucheng), Kuqa, Xinjiang Province

China: Zhaoguli Buddhist Temple, Subashi Ancient City (Subashi Gucheng), Kuqa, Xinjiang Province

Zhaoguli Buddhist Temple dates from the 5th century AD. The site was first excavated by Count Otani Kozui of Kyoto in the early 20th century.

The ruins of Subashi Gucheng (Subashi Ancient City) are all that is left of the ancient capital of the Kingdom of Qiuci that existed from the 4th century AD until it was abandoned sometime in the 12th century.


CPA Media Co. Ltd.


David Henley


Pictures From Asia